分子沉积(MD)膜驱剂多羟基三季铵盐的合成、吸附与润湿性能  被引量:4

Synthesis,Adsorption and Wettability of Organic Polyhydroxyl Triammonium Salt as Molecular Deposition Filming/Flooding Agent

摘  要:国内分子沉积(MD)膜驱油中使用的膜驱剂为单分子双季铵盐。以二甲胺、环氧氯丙烷、2-二甲氨基乙醇为原料,合成了一种可用作MD膜驱剂多羟基的单分子三季铵盐。在25℃、中性条件下,该多羟基三季铵盐在内蒙古图牧吉油砂上吸附5 h达到平衡,饱和吸附量为16 mg/g,温度升高时饱和吸附量降低。吸附等温线符合Langmuir定律,表明为单分子层吸附,且吸附为放热过程。接触角测定结果表明,该多羟基三季铵盐能够使亲油的砂岩表面(98.985°)转变为弱亲油(83.592°),亲水的砂岩表面(50.665°)更加亲水(35.408°),使带有负电的亲油砂岩表面(107.672°)由亲油性向亲水性的转变更加明显(72.000°)。NaCl的加入有利于砂岩表面的润湿性转变。The molecular deposition film forming material (MDFFM) cornmonoly used as EOR chemical in China is organic diammoniumslats. A new MDFFM, polyhydroxyl triammonium salt (PHTAS), is prepared from dimethylamine, epiehlorohydin, and dimethylhydroxyethyamine by a procedure described in some detail with its chemical structure presented. The adsorption of the MDFFM on oily sand of Tumuji, Inner Mongolia, at 25℃ in neutral solutions reaches its equilibrium in 5 hrs and the saturation adsorption obtained is of 16 mg/g sand and decreases with increasing temperature (25--60℃). The adsorption isotherms fit to Langmuir's mode, which indicates monolayer adsorption occured and the adsorption is exothermal. In contact angle measurements on sandstone plate samples with MDFFM aqueous solutions it is shown that oleophitie sandstone surfaces ( contact angle 98. 985℃ ) are altered to weaker oleophilie ones (83. 592℃ ), hydrophilie sandstone surfaces (50. 665℃)--to more hydrophilie ones (35. 408°) and negatively charged oleophilie sandstone surfaces (106. 672°)--to hydrophilie ones (72. 000°) with the MDFFM added in water. Introducing NaCl into MDFFM solution promotes wettability alternation of sandstone surfaces.
